Strategies for Learners with Special Needs in Building Trades.
Missouri Univ., Columbia. Missouri LINC.
This Vocational Instructional Management System module provides information regarding instructional/teaching strategies and cognitive/learning strategies as well as other information for successful learning to assist Missouri building trades teachers and special needs students in confronting building trades competencies with a strategic plan. Ten definitions, 11 frequently asked questions, 2 resources, and 5 references are included. The following questions are answered: What types of strategies might be used? Why should I teach strategies? Who needs to be taught strategies? How often do I need to use strategies? How do I include instructional strategies in my daily lessons? What strategies can both students and teachers use? How does paraphrasing work as a learning strategy? What strategies will help with reading comprehension? What is reciprocal teaching? How can I teach students tools of measurement? and What are some additional materials that I can use with my class to teach building trades? (three sources are listed). The following resources are included: (1) sample study guide; and (2) bridging example. (NLA)
